A discrete event system (DES) is a dynamic system whose state transitions are caused by physical phenomena, called events, occurring abruptly at unknown irregular intervals. Examples include manufacturing systems, computer and communication networks and traffic systems. The supervisory control theory (SCT) is recognized as one of effective tools for the analysis and control of the DESs. In SCT, the control objective is to restrict the plant behavior such that(s.t.) it remains confined within a specific range. Recently, there has also been many studies considering the optimal supervisory control problem (OSCP) in which the control objective is to restrict the system behavior so that a certain cost function defined along the trajectory of the system is optimized. In the OSCP, it is impossible to optimize the system for all aspects. For example, in order to complete a task in short time, we have to consume a lot of energy. Thus, we have to decide what we optimize and then define the cost function which is suitable to our purpose. In this dissertation, we study optimal control problems for the DESs. First, we formulate the OSCP with the cost function using the disabling costs of the events and the penalties of the states which is useful in the system design. Then, we devise an algorithm to design the optimal nonblocking supervisor to solve the problem. Since the proposed algorithm has polynomial-order computational complexity, we can solve the problem efficiently. Then, we formulate the power distribution network restoration problem to an OSCP and solve it using the proposed algorithm as a case study. Next, we extend the results to the partial observation cases. In the OSCP under partial observation, the optimal supervisor for the given DES has restrictions that it must makes the controlled system``s behavior observable as well as it is a nonblocking supervisor.
